Date nights with your partner can be so much more than just binge-watching shows on the couch after the kids are asleep. It’s crucial to carve out quality time together, especially when life gets busy juggling parenting, work, and everything in between. But who says you need a big budget for memorable outings? While cozy nights at home are nice, stepping out for something fun doesn’t have to drain your wallet.

Exploring affordable date options not only allows you to save some cash but also sparks your romantic creativity. Here are over 30 inexpensive date ideas to consider for your next weekend:

  1. Visit a local coffee shop that has board games on hand.
  2. Take a leisurely stroll through a nearby park.
  3. Investigate which museums offer free admission days and plan a visit.
  4. Attend a free outdoor concert and bring along a picnic.
  5. Enjoy some window shopping at the mall.
  6. Wander around Costco and indulge in free samples—seriously!
  7. Check out an art opening for some culture and complimentary wine.
  8. Participate in a lecture at your local library or historical society.
  9. Dedicate an hour to give each other relaxing massages.
  10. Find a sushi spot with half-price deals and indulge.
  11. Explore a farmers’ market together.
  12. Catch a matinee at a local theater or enjoy a cheaper production.
  13. Spend a day volunteering at a charity you both support.
  14. Depending on the season, go berry or apple picking.
  15. Visit a public garden to learn about different plants.
  16. Take a glass of wine outside and stargaze together.
  17. Go roller skating or ice skating for some nostalgic fun.
  18. Browse through flea markets or estate sales for hidden treasures.
  19. Seek out a place with happy hour specials for affordable drinks and appetizers.
  20. Teach each other a new skill or hobby.
  21. Use portrait mode on your phone to take fun pictures of each other—everyone needs a new profile pic!
  22. If public transport is available, hop on a train or bus to the end of the line and explore the area.
  23. Start a book club just for the two of you.
  24. Join a couples yoga class for some relaxation.
  25. Plan a scavenger hunt for one another and enjoy the adventure.
  26. Create and compare travel bucket lists for future trips.
  27. Attend a real estate open house for a fun outing with free snacks.
  28. Host a bonfire night in your backyard and make s’mores.
  29. Find a local brewery or winery offering free tours and tastings.
  30. Check out a 21+ arcade for some playful competition.
  31. Enjoy an open mic night, whether you’re performing or just spectating.
